What is the Strawberry Dream Cocktail?
The Strawberry Dream Cocktail is a sophisticated blend of fresh strawberries, high-quality gin, lemon juice, honey, and a unique addition of Greek yogurt for creaminess.
What makes this cocktail unique?
This cocktail stands out due to the inclusion of unsweetened Greek yogurt and a dash of freshly ground black pepper to enhance the herbal gin notes.
What kind of gin should I use?
A high-quality gin is recommended to ensure the herbal notes are properly complemented by the black pepper and strawberry.
Can I substitute the gin with another spirit?
Yes, this versatile recipe works well with variations using blanco tequila or aged rum.
Why is Greek yogurt added to the drink?
Greek yogurt provides a delightful creamy texture and a hint of tanginess that balances the sweetness of the honey and strawberries.
How do I prepare the strawberries?
You should hull the large ripe strawberries before muddling them in the shaker.
What if I don't have a cocktail muddler?
If you do not have a muddler, you can use the back of a spoon to break down the strawberries and release their juices.
What is the purpose of the black pepper?
Freshly ground black pepper is used to enhance the herbal notes of the gin and add an aromatic touch to the drink.
How long should I shake the cocktail?
Shake the mixture vigorously for about 15 seconds until it is well chilled.
Why do I need to use a double strainer?
A double strainer is used to ensure all strawberry solids and seeds are removed, resulting in a smooth cocktail.
What type of glass is best for this cocktail?
This cocktail is best served in a rocks glass filled with crushed ice.

Can I use frozen strawberries?
While fresh strawberries are recommended for better flavor and easier muddling, thawed frozen strawberries can be used in a pinch.
What is the garnish for this cocktail?
The cocktail is garnished with a vertical slice of strawberry on the rim.
How much honey is required?
The recipe calls for 1/2 ounce of undiluted honey.
Can I use flavored yogurt?
The recipe specifically calls for plain, unsweetened Greek yogurt to maintain the balance of sweet and tart flavors.

Can I make this without alcohol?
You could omit the gin for a creamy strawberry mocktail, though the flavor profile will significantly change.
When should the black pepper be added?
The black pepper should be ground over the top of the finished drink as a final aromatic touch.
